Output 21d8620131e7dfdd75295e295f778155e7f2628dcbb9611a10bef18f049c5909:1

value
20754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1a8c2d02e99e959c6f948aa56b78185659fb68 OP_EQUAL
address
3QrbMpqcdYG2zLLbH6SwLVu38aam6LMDaW
transaction
21d8620131e7dfdd75295e295f778155e7f2628dcbb9611a10bef18f049c5909
spent
true